Daten vom Server aus über ftp client versenden

loisl

Registered User
Huhu,

habe mir schon den ganzen Tag einen Wolf gegoogelt, aber weiss nicht so recht nach was ich suchen soll .... das ist mein Problem ;-(

Ich möchte Daten (Bilder ca. 20 - 300 Stück a 1,5 MB) direkt vom (ROOT)-Server (extern nur SSH, http oder FTP ... Zugriff) per FTP in ein Verzeichnis stellen. OK

Dann bräuchte ich so was wie einen FTP-Clienten, den ich z.B. per Web-Browser konfigurieren kann und die Daten aus dem Verzeichnis an eine Auswahl (von 25 - 300) von Empfängern per FTP senden kann.

Ich hoffe so was gibt es schon und Ihr habt für mich einen Lösungsansatz!

Danke und lg loisl
 
Last edited by a moderator:
Hallo,

Du hast dich glaube ich ein bisschen schwer verständlich ausgedrückt.

Ich fasse mal zusammen:

Du hast einen Rootserver und möchtest per FTP Dateien an mehrere Benutzer verschicken?

Dazu kannst du einfach das Linux Programm "ftp" nutzen. Rsync wäre eine elegantere Lösung aber mit ftp sollte es auch funktionieren.

Du kannst für FTP jeweils pro Host eine Konfig-Datei anlegen.

Dann solltest du dir ein Bashscript schreiben was folgenes macht:

Für jede vorhande Konfig-Datei in einem bestimmten Verzeichniss (wo alle FTP Host Konfigs liegen) soll er ftp mit der jeweiligen Konfig aufrufen.

FERTIG :)
 
Hallo!
Die Bilder sind schon auf dem Server oder sollen via FTP auf den Server? Was genau ist mit sollen in ein Verzeichnis gestellt werden gemeint? Innerhalb des Servers? Dann bietet sich mv (move) oder cp (copy) an.

Edit: Zu langsam :).

mfG
Thorsten
 
Hallo,

danke erst einmal für die Antworten ....
trotz schwer verständlich, habt Ihr mein Problem verstanden.

Der Datenversand an meinen Server (per FTP) mit UMTS, WLan oder sonstwie ist klar und funktioniert!

Jetzt sollen die Daten (in diesem neuen Verzeichnis) per FTP an mehrere Empfänger versandt werden. Der Einfachheit vielleicht zum Auswählen nach Empfängergruppen wie Z.B. Tageszeitungen-München, Tageszeitungen-Berlin, Tageszeitungen-Hamurg, Yellopress, National, International .....

Da dann das ganze ziemlich schnell gehen soll, möchte ich mich nicht zu diesem Zweck in die Konsole einloggen und einzeln die Befehlzeilen eingeben ... deshalb dachte ich da an irgend eine Lösung über den Browser um dadurch das ganze zu steuern.

Soll ich das ganze über php und mysql lösen ??? oder giebt es bessere Ideen

lg loisl und gute n8
 
Hallo,

Das kannst du eigentlich handhaben wie du möchtest und in der Sprache in der du am besten Programmieren kannst.

Sicherlich ist es eine gute Idee, alle Benutzer mit ihren Daten in eine MySQL einzutragen. Ein PHP Script könnte dann die Auswahl und die Stapelverarbeitung übernehmen.

Ich denke mal, ein fähiger PHP Programmierer sollte dafür nicht länger als 2 Stunden brauchen.
 
Back
Top